NetTimeLogic’s PTP Timestamp Unit is an implementation of a single port Frame Timestamp Unit (TSU) according to IEEE1588-2008 (PTP). It detects PTP frames on a (R)(G)MII tap and timestamps PTP event frames based on a Counter Clock and provides them delay compensated to a PTP Software stack (e.g. PTPd, PTP4l, etc). The PTP Ordinary Clock (OC) from NetTimeLogic is a combination of NetTimeLogic's PTP Transparent Clock (TC) and PTP Ordinary Clock (OC). It adds the Sync and Announce message processors to the design which allow synchronization of the clock according to IEEE1588 while keeping the timing aware frame forwarding feature of the TC. Drivers to support SoC-e's HW IEEE 1588 time stamping. These are drivers to support SoC-e s hardware for PTP (IEEE 1588) time stamping in Xilinx FPGAs. A simple and useful API is included. As an example, modified platform dependant files of ptpd2 are included. NOTE: Only for Petalinux + SoC-e s HW.

Sep 17, 2020 · The Precision Time Protocol (PTP) is a high-precision time synchronization protocol for networked measurement and control systems. It is defined in the IEEE 1588 standard, which is designed for local systems requiring very high accuracies - beyond those attainable using NTP (Network Time Protocol). PTP makes it.
Jun 06, 2018 · IEEE 1588 Precision Time Protocol (PTP) is a packet-based two-way communications protocol specifically designed to precisely synchronize distributed clocks to sub-microsecond resolution, typically on an Ethernet or IP-based network. 1588 can.
This paper describes basic principles of PTP, information on using dual Grandmasters, and the requirements of the network to achieve sub-100 nanosecond time synchronization. Hardware Assisted IEEE 1588 IP Core. The necessary FPGA logic to assist SW protocol stack in implementing the Precision Time Protocol (IEEE 1588-2008) on 1000M/100M/10M Ethernet networks. PTP packets transmitting and receiving should be implemented by PTP SW protocol stack (PTPd) with existing MAC function; This IP Core implements the Real-Time.

Comcores IEEE 1588 PTP Solution is a high performance clock synchronization solution that includes both hardware and software components. The PTP solution is fully compliant with IEEE 1588v2.1 standard and enables time synchronization across multiple devices. The solution supports IEEE 802.1AS profile making it ideal for TSN applications. The fully autonomously operated IP includes XGMII and ....
